This week I want to show you a project that proves Molly Ringwald isn’t the only one who is Pretty in Pink! It doesn’t matter whether you are using white horses or black horses the available pink traits really “pop” on either.  The hair, bridle, eye, horn, and hoof/socks all match so well and look lovely together.  I am sure that if you look closely thru the Amaretto Horse wiki you will find other wings or eyes that would also work beautifully on a pink project of your own but for this blog I am showing off the Carnation eye matched with the Sweetheart wing (which you can also match with the Sweetheart branding).  Using those traits with the Pink Socks or Raspberry hooves, Mystique Fuchsia Wild Hair, Pink Bridle and the Bloom Horn will make one of the great ‘Pretty in Pink’ horses you see below in the pictures.
